The Accused

7.0 111 mins Crime   Drama   1988
Paramount Pictures Canada   Paramount Pictures   Jaffe-Lansing  
Director(s): Jonathan Kaplan

Out drinking one night after a fight with her boyfriend, three men brutally rape Sarah Tobias in a bar while people watch and cheer. District Attorney Kathryn Murphy takes the case; however, she allows the rapists to receive a mild sentence. A distraught Sarah decides to seek punishment for the men who witnessed and encouraged the rape. To get justice, Sarah must take the stand and revisit the night of her attack.
